Job Title: Phlebotomist Job Description We are seeking a dedicated and skilled Phlebotomist to join our team in Auburn Hills. The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ience in an outpatient setting, responsible for drawing and processing patient samples efficiently and accurately. Responsibilities • Draw patient blood samples, process them correctly, and package them appropriately, performing this task 25-30 times per day. • Communicate daily with clinic staff to organize and schedule blood draws, and arrange for the pickup and shipping of samples to the medical testing sites. Essential Skills • At least 2 Years of experience as a Phlebotomist or Medical Assistant with duties including drawing, processing, and packaging samples. • Phlebotomy or Medical Assistant certification or certificate. • Knowledge of the order of draw and BD Vacutainer order of draw tube colors for multiple tube collections. Additional Skills & Qualifications • High School Diploma. Work Environment The position requires a commitment to working Monday through Thursday, 8 AM to 4 PM, with a training schedule varying in Farmington (2 weeks). The worksite will be in Auburn Hills.
